Maplewood is a city located in St. Louis County, Missouri. It has a population of 8,000 and is an inner-ring suburb of St. Louis. Residents living in St. Louis are less than eight miles from downtown St. Louis.
Students who live in Maplewood are serviced by the Maplewood-Richmond Heights School District, where they attend Maplewood-Richmond Heights High School. You have many entertainment options that you can explore around St. Louis. As one of the first major cities constructed during the United States' westward expansion, St. Louis is home to a rich history that tells the story of the United States frontier. One of the ways that you can get a better understanding of this part of American history is by visiting the Gateway Arch, which stretches over the Mississippi River.
If you are interested in learning more about the history of St. Louis, as well as the country's history as a whole, stop by the Missouri Civil War Museum. There are a number of interesting exhibits that tell St. Louis' story during this complicated time in history. Another excellent facility to visit is the City Museum, which has many types of hands-on exhibits that tell the story and history of St. Louis. This museum is geared towards family members of all ages, so it's guaranteed to be an exciting experience.
Before you leave St. Louis, make sure that you stop by Busch Stadium and see the St. Louis Cardinals play one of their home games. This baseball club has a rich and successful history, as well as an intense rivalry with the Chicago Cubs. Their fan base makes sure that every game is an exciting and enjoyable experience.
